[PROCURING OF ІNTRAOPERATIVE HEMOSTASIS IN REVASCULARIZATION INTERVENTIONS]
Klinichna Khirurhiia
|October 2, 2018
Summary
This study on vascular surgery patients found hypercoagulation post-operation due to thrombinemia. Early heparin use is crucial for preventing blood clots and improving outcomes.
Area of Science:
- Vascular Surgery
- Hemostasis
- Thrombosis
Background:
- Atherosclerotic disease affects aorta and lower extremity arteries, requiring revascularization.
- Surgical intervention can lead to hypercoagulation in the early postoperative period.
- This hypercoagulation is linked to thrombinemia and reduced fibrinolytic activity.
Purpose of the Study:
- To analyze hemostasis management in patients undergoing revascularization for atherosclerotic disease.
- To investigate the causes of postoperative hypercoagulation.
- To establish optimal thromboprophylaxis strategies.
Main Methods:
- Studied 106 patients operated on for atherosclerotic affection of the aorta and lower extremity arteries.
- Monitored hemostasis parameters in the early postoperative period.
- Evaluated the efficacy of different heparin protocols.
Main Results:
- Hypercoagulation syndrome was observed post-surgery, characterized by thrombinemia and fibrinolytic depression.
- Non-fractionated heparins administered immediately post-operation effectively impacted the thrombin-fibrinogen factor (factor IIa).
- Prolonged thromboprophylaxis with low-molecular heparins (targeting factor Xa) aligned with established standards.
Conclusions:
- Immediate postoperative administration of non-fractionated heparin is necessary to manage the thrombin-fibrinogen factor.
- Continued thromboprophylaxis with low-molecular heparin is essential for preventing postoperative complications.
- This approach addresses hypercoagulation by targeting key factors in the hemocoagulant cascade.

Introduction to Hemostasis
14.3K
Hemostasis is a complex physiological process that prevents excessive bleeding when a blood vessel is injured. It's crucial for maintaining the integrity of the circulatory system, as it ensures that our blood remains fluid while still within the vascular network and yet clots to prevent blood loss upon vessel injury.
